PHOENIX -- For the third time in six days, a big rig crash has closed part of Interstate 10 in the Phoenix metropolitan area.
Arizona Department of Public Safety officials say a semi-truck overturned Tuesday afternoon on I-10 near the Riggs Road exit south of Chandler.
A westbound lane of I-10 was closed during the rush hour and traffic is being diverted. It was reopened about 6:00 p.m.
DPS said they cleaned up some spilled fuel from the rollover and the big rig's driver escaped injury.
Last Wednesday morning, a semi-truck hauling mulch rolled over on I-10 near Phoenix Sky Harbor International Airport at the I-17 junction in Phoenix.
On Thursday morning, the driver of a big rig was killed when his semi-truck crashed into a barrier on Interstate 10 in Tempe and caught fire.
